Title: Re: My15M MkIV running strong on 900SS Post by YaBB Administrator on 04/05/11 at 07:31:43
There's a little description at the end of this page about starts - http://www.cajinnovations.com/MyECU/FirstSteps.htm .
Until you find the right settings make sure you keep the bike battery on the charger, even while starting, and do labour the starter motor past 5 seconds. A common mistake is to be too rich. Can you smell fuel? Maybe a quick check of the plug my tell you. |

Title: Re: My15M MkIV running strong on 900SS Post by raz on 04/06/11 at 22:52:08
You might want to sort out all teething problems (at least with engine starting) before installing the sprag clutch. I've heard of cases where heavy kick-backs destroyed them. This is not specific to MyECU except for the fact that you have a greater chance of being out of tune when experimenting (or with a new MyECU)
